Narakagatyanupurvi means retaining form of previous life before hellish one and so on waren Agurulaghu. Neither too heavy to move nor too light to have stability, 39a Upaghata. The possession of a self-destructive limb or or gan which becomes the cause of one's own death. As a kind of stag with horns, which when they become too heavy, cause his death, gran Paraghata. Possessed of a limb or organ fatal to others, e. g., the sting of a scorpian, etc. 51a9 Atupa. Radiant heat Possessed of a body which is brilliant and bearable to the owner but intolerable and heating for the others. Such as the gross earth-bodied souls in the Sun from which sunshine comes [Hot light like Sun-shine.] sala Udyota Phosphorescence. An Uluminated body like that of the fire-fly Such as the earth-bodied souls in the moon. (Cold light like Moon-shine.] 09 Uchchhyasa Respiration. 2 fagreitola Vihayogati. Capacity of moving in 19121, space This is of 2 kinds (1) Jeffe Kafs Shubhartha yogati, Graceful, like that of a swan (2) safarifa Aslubhavihawgati, Awkward scheric, Prat peksharla Aboly possessed and enjoyable by one soul only, as a mango. HARTORICIT, Sadharanasharira One body possessed and enjoyable by many souls; as a potato, etc Trasa Mobile. Having a body with 2, 3, 4, 5, senses. ZUTA, Sthavara. Immobile Having a body with one sense only, 2. e, touch. 947, Subhaaga. Amiable personality even though not beautiful.
